The form below is for use by volunteers wishing to become a Client Support Volunteer with CarPal Community Rideshare.
Client Support Volunteers assess and train our new clients to use our service so that they can overcome Shut-in Syndrome by getting out and about around Sydney. This involves:
- Meet the Client (and/or Sponsor) to assess eligibility
- Explain processes used by CarPal, including role of Facilitators/Sponsors
- Enrol clients, including ID Pic & Agreement
- Create an entry for the Client in CarPal’s Ride scheduling App
- Provide Facilitator contact info to Client
- Monitor Client 1st Ride Requests
Provided you are 18 years or older and live in Sydney, you can help Shut-in Seniors join and successfully use the CarPal Community Rideshare service.
After we receive your details we’ll send you an email with information about obtaining a Police Check and our induction and training program for the role. Some of the training is online.
This is followed by a few hours face-to-face in our Baulkham Hills office and then visiting new Clients accompanied by a CarPal Trainer.
The role involves visiting potential new Sydney Hills clients in their homes or retirement villages at a time to suit the volunteer.
